Chip co ASOCS raises $3m

ASOCS develops embedded processors for converged communications on mobile devices.

Sources inform ''Globes'' that communications processor developer ASOCS Ltd. has raised $3 million. Taylor Frigon Capital Partners LP of the US led the round, which boosts the amount of capital raised by the company to $35-40 million. Daniel Recanati and George Guilder also participated in the round.

ASOCS chief scientist Prof. Simon Litsyn of Tel Aviv University and CTO Doron Solomon founded the company in 2003. The company develops embedded processors for converged communications on mobile devices via a range of mobile and wireless protocols on a single processor. It also develops wireless applications, such as digital television.

Other investors include Israel's Vertex Venture Capital, Forum Group, Harel Hertz Investment House Ltd., and angel investor Gideon Ben-Zvi, as well as Japan's Fujitsu Ltd. (TSE: 6702) and FGC.
